| Cardiac Plexus |
|
| |
Interconnected group of nerves situated behind the breastbone, corresponding to the anahata chakra. |
|
| Chakra |
|
| |
Wheel or Vortex of energy in the body. Major psychic center in the subtle body which is responsible for specific physiological and psychic functions. |
|
| Chi or Qi |
|
| |
The Chinese word for life force, also known as "Chi". Life energy that flows throughout the body through specific pathways, or "meridians". In yoga the equivalent of this life force is "prana" and the pathways are "nadis" (sanskrit). |
|
| Chidakasha |
|
| |
Psychic space behind the forehead where all psychic events are viewed. "Third Eye". Space of conciousness. |
|
| Cin-mudra |
|
| |
Common hand gesture (mudra) in meditation (dhyana), which is formed by bringing the tips of the index finger and the thumb together, while the remaining fingers are kept straight. |
|
| Circadian Rhythms |
|
| |
The physiological rhythms people experience through the course of a 24-hour day. |
|
| Cit |
|
| |
The superconscious ultimate reality. |
|
| Citta |
|
| |
Ordinary consciousness, the mind, as opposed to cit. Mental activity. |
